Can you warm up mashed potatoes?
When all you want is mashed potatoes fast and you’re reheating food in the microwave already, try this: Move the potatoes to a covered dish and heat them in the microwave at half-power for five minutes, stirring occasionally. Once hot, stir well, and add additional dairy and butter, as needed. PSA!

What foods are healthy for Thanksgiving?
“Thanksgiving is a holiday where there’s plenty of opportunity to eat healthy,” says Wendy Kaplan , M.S., RDN, CDN, a registered dietitian nutritionist. “Staples such as green beans, Brussels sprouts, sweet potatoes, cranberries, corn, pumpkin and turkey are all nutrient-rich options to pile on your plate.”.
What foods are common on Thanksgiving?
Traditional Thanksgiving food (not to be confused with the food served at the original feast, only some of which is still served today) consists of a roasted turkey, gravy, stuffing (dressing), mashed potatoes, sweet potatoes, green beans, cranberry sauce, and pumpkin or pecan pie.
